#1ee143 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ee143 is composed of 11.8% red, 88.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 131.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 50%. #1ee143 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ff86 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1ee143 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ee143 has RGB values of R:30, G:225,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 2023747.

Shades and Tints of #1ee143
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021105 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ee143
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76897a is the less saturated color, while #01fe31 is the most saturated one.
